What are Mora knives used for?

The term originates from knives manufactured by the cutleries in Mora, Dalarna. In Sweden and Finland, Mora knives are extensively used in construction and in industry as general-purpose tools. Mora knives are also used by all Scandinavian armies as an everyday knife.

Where are Morakniv based?

Mora Sweden
Morakniv knives have been designed and manufactured in Mora Sweden since 1891. This long history has given us total control of the manufacturing process – from metallurgy to final finishes. Our knives are used in the toughest conditions all over the world.

How thick is a Mora knife?

Almost all Mora blades measure out to one of four lengths: ~3.5″ (91mm), ~3.75″ (95mm), ~4″ (104mm), or ~4.25″ (109mm). Blade thicknesses also fall into three groups: 0.079″ (2mm), 0.098″ (2.5mm), and 0.125″ (3.2mm). With the thickest blades at 1/8″, there are no sharpened pry bars from this brand.

What knife does the Swedish military use?

Fällkniven is best known as a supplier of military and outdoor knives, supplying the Swedish military. The Fällkniven model F1 has been the official survival knife for pilots in the Swedish Air Force since 1995.

How old is my Mora knife?

Mora, one of the world’s largest knife manufacturers, has come a long way in its development. The beginning of its history dates back to 1891, when master Eric Frost founded his knife factory. This is how the largest knife company in Mora – Frost Knivfabrik – was born.

How is Morakniv made?

When a knife is constructed, we select the steel that best matches what the knife will be used for; carbon steel, stainless steel or laminated steel. Two knife blades a second are made in the pressing hall. That adds up to a huge 7,000 blades an hour! The power in the press is 120 tons.
